I've heard that baggers aren't trained to pack ANY kind of bag. Here are some tips for packing the tote bags:

Lesson #1 - PLEASE, do not put all of the cans in the same blue bag. Those things hold A LOT. If it is all cans, I cannot lift it.

Lesson #2 - Learn what to put in the insulated bags. I try to group my cold stuff together, so this is easier to figure out. However, I've gotten some really stupid stuff placed in those things before.

Lesson #3 - The insultated bags have zippers on top for a reason. SO ZIP THEM!!!

Lesson #4 - If I'm using these bags then obviously (or maybe not so obvious) I am trying not to waste those plastic bags. So PLEASE do not put only one item in each plastic bag you have to use since I don't have space in my blue bags. Let's not be wasteful. One thing of syrup does not need its own bag. It can share with the fabric softener refill.

Lesson #5 - ONE PERSON CAN'T PUSH TWO CARTS!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!
